A PREVIEW OF RADIO CHART PREVIEWS

At Top 40 radio G-Eazy's "Me, Myself & I" f/BeBe Rexha (RCA) will remain at the top of the chart this week, but don't be surprised if DNCE's "Cake By the Ocean" (Republic) moves in for the win at the last minute, while Warner Bros. Lukas Graham becomes the chart's Greatest Gainer with "7 Years."

Meanwhile at Rhythm, Rihanna holds at #1 again this week with "Work" (Westbury Road/Roc Nation), but after a phenomenal eight weeks on top this should be her last, with Jeremih's "Oui" (Def Jam) poised to take the top slot next.

At Modern Rock, The Lumineers (Dualtone) should go Top 5 this week with "Ophelia," and there were some impressive chart jumps for Aurora's "Conqueror" (Glassnote) which moved 37*-30* and Bishop's "River" (Teleport), rising 40*-32*.
